Output ff24e6328a1d18204e720c6610acde2bb05e8d962e97b1fa76c1d8842f7ca865:0

value
1031553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51e2ed83fcb4a17340d2c51caf623b16b52c8813 OP_EQUAL
address
399zWJSzeE9ZEzw1QqCMyge3ZYV7KcFHtC
transaction
ff24e6328a1d18204e720c6610acde2bb05e8d962e97b1fa76c1d8842f7ca865
spent
true